山西绵山植被优势种群的分布格局与种间联结的研究

RESEARCH ON THE PATTERN AND ASSOCIATIONS BETWEEN DOMINANTS OF THE VEGETATION IN MIAN MOUNTAIN, SHANXI PROVINCE

  • 摘要: 本文用方差/平均数比率的方法和通过2×2列联表进行X2检验的方法,研究了山西绵山植被优势种的分布格局及种间联结性。结果表明:绵山优势种都服从集群分布;种间的正联结是物种对同质生境有相同适应性的反应;种问的负联结则是不同物种对异质生境适应性不同所致。在用X2检验研究物种联结性的同时,用点相关系数来刻划种间的联结性强度,作为对种间联结的辅助说明是完全必要的。通过对种间联结的分析,还可以看出绵山植被的动态演替趋势。

     

    Abstract: In this paper, the method of variance/mean ratio and χ2 test by 2×2 contingency table are used to study the pattern and associations between dominants of the vegetation in Mian Mountain, Shanxi Province. The results indicated that the pattern of dominants follows contagious distribution, that the positive association between species is due to the same suitability of species for homogeneous habitat, that the negetive association is due to the different adaptabitity of different species for heterogeneous habitat. Besides, χ2 test is used to study association between species, association intensity between species is measured by point correlation coefficient. It is necessary that point correlation coefficient is calculated as supplementary interpretation to association between species. By analysising association between species, dynamic succession tendency of the vegetation in Mian Mountain may be seen.
